Ifo’s business sentiment index in Germany has risen to a historic peak
Ifo’s business sentiment index in Germany has risen to a historic peak in June, indicating that the euro area’s largest economy remained strong in the second half of the year.
According to the Institute’s Monday report, the business sentiment index rose to 115.1 from the 114.6 points of May. Analysts expected 114.4 points.
The sub-index of the index, which quantifies the current economic environment, rose to 124.1 points from the 123.3 points of the previous month. Analysts expected a slight increase of 123.3 points. (MTI)
